What stages of the water cycle is most likely occurring on a clear hot sunny day?

On a clear hot sunny day, evaporation and transpiration are likely occurring. Evaporation is the process of water turning into water vapor from surfaces like oceans, lakes, and rivers, while transpiration is when plants release water vapor into the atmosphere through their leaves.

Why do People sprinkle water on roof after a hot sunny day give reason?

Sprinkling water on the roof after a hot sunny day can help cool down the surface temperature by evaporative cooling. The water absorbs heat from the roof and evaporates into the air, taking away some of the heat in the process. This can help regulate the temperature inside the building and reduce the overall energy usage for cooling.
